At its core, net worth is a straightforward equation that represents the difference between what you own and what you owe. On the asset side of the ledger, you will find everything that holds monetary value and contributes positively to your financial standing. This includes cash and cash equivalents in checking and savings accounts, the equity in real estate properties, investments in stocks, bonds, retirement accounts like 401(k)s and IRAs, and the cash value of life insurance policies. Tangible assets such as vehicles, jewelry, and collectibles also factor in, though they are often valued at their current market price or a conservative estimate rather than the original purchase price. The accumulation of these assets over time, through savings, investment returns, and income generation, is the primary driver of net worth growth. Conversely, liabilities represent financial obligations that drain your resources. This category encompasses credit card debt, personal loans, student loans, auto loans, and, most significantly, mortgage debt on primary residences or investment properties. The mathematical simplicity of subtracting total liabilities from total assets belies the psychological and strategic weight these numbers carry, as the goal for most individuals is to systematically reduce the liabilities while growing the asset base.
The impact of Hon Lik’s invention was both swift and seismic. By the mid-2000s, the e-cigarette began to spread beyond China, capturing the attention of smokers in Europe and North America who were looking for a less harmful alternative or a viable cessation tool. The device’s appeal was multifaceted. For many, it was a practical tool to quit combustible cigarettes. For others, it was a way to maintain the social rituals and sensory pleasures of smoking— the hand-to-mouth action, the inhalation, the vapor cloud—without the offensive smell and tar. The market exploded. Traditional tobacco giants, finally recognizing the disruption, began to acquire early vaping companies or develop their own versions. Hon Lik, the pharmacist with a personal mission, found himself at the heart of a burgeoning global industry. His name became synonymous with a new way to consume nicotine, a technology that redefined the smoking landscape.
